> In message <202102251327.11PDR4eC083842@gitrepo.freebsd.org>, Baptiste > Daroussi > n writes: > > The branch main has been updated by bapt: > > > > URL: https://cgit.FreeBSD.org/src/commit/?id=2a50a9de8340f08bd876e9e5993332ae > > 14376f80 > > > > commit 2a50a9de8340f08bd876e9e5993332ae14376f80 > > Author: Baptiste Daroussin <bapt@FreeBSD.org> > > AuthorDate: 2021-02-23 16:17:32 +0000 > > Commit: Baptiste Daroussin <bapt@FreeBSD.org> > > CommitDate: 2021-02-25 13:25:32 +0000 > > > > terminfo: add terminfo database > > > > Tested by: manu, jbeich > > --- > > share/Makefile | 1 + > > share/terminfo/Makefile | 34 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 > > 2 files changed, 35 insertions(+) > > > > diff --git a/share/Makefile b/share/Makefile > > index c4e12b05f7db..d6854b230ae5 100644 > > --- a/share/Makefile > > +++ b/share/Makefile > > @@ -26,6 +26,7 @@ SUBDIR= ${_colldef} \ > > ${_syscons} \ > > tabset \ > > termcap \ > > + terminfo \ > > ${_timedef} \ > > ${_vt} \ > > ${_zoneinfo} > > diff --git a/share/terminfo/Makefile b/share/terminfo/Makefile > > new file mode 100644 > > index 000000000000..7bb11f3fdf24 > > --- /dev/null > > +++ b/share/terminfo/Makefile > > @@ -0,0 +1,34 @@ > > +PACKAGE= runtime > > + > > +.PATH: ${SRCTOP}/contrib/ncurses/misc > > +TINFOBUILDDIR= ${.OBJDIR}/builddir > > +CLEANDIRS+= builddir > > + > > +.include <src.tools.mk> > > + > > +.if !defined(_SKIP_BUILD) > > +all: terminfo > > +.endif > > +META_TARGETS+= terminfo install-terminfo > > + > > +terminfo: terminfo.src > > + mkdir -p ${TINFOBUILDDIR} > > + ${TIC_CMD} -x -o ${TINFOBUILDDIR} ${.ALLSRC} > > + > > +.if make(*install*) > > +TINFOS!= cd ${TINFOBUILDDIR} && find * -type f | LC_ALL=C sort > > +TINFOSDIRS= ${TINFOS:C/(.).*/\1/g:O:u} > > +.endif > > + > > +beforeinstall: install-terminfo > > +install-terminfo: > > + mkdir -p ${DESTDIR}/usr/share/terminfo > > + cd ${DESTDIR}/usr/share/terminfo; mkdir -p ${TINFOSDIRS} > > +.for f in ${TINFOS} > > + ${INSTALL} ${TAG_ARGS} \ > > + -o ${BINOWN} -g ${BINGRP} -m ${NOBINMODE} \ > > + ${TINFOBUILDDIR}/${f} ${DESTDIR}/usr/share/terminfo/${f} > > +.endfor > > + > > +.include <bsd.prog.mk> > > + > > > > I think this had some unintended consequences, a POLA violation that should > be documented. Our termcap didn't support alternate screen buffers while > terminfo does. Termcap did through t_te and t_ti but we didn't use them. > Terminfo as delivered from the ncurses factory does supply rmcup and smcup; > our fullscreen apps such as nvi and top see them and use the alternate > screen buffer. > > The use of the alternate screen buffer is one of the things I hate about > Linux. After running vi or top I expect the output to remain on the screen > so I can use some bit of information in my next command. We now have this > behaviour too. I believe LESS also does this kind of stuff, or atleast "man" on linux does, and that pees me off to no end when I quit the man page and what I wanted is no longer on the screen. > The alternate screen buffer was added to xterm an ice age ago. Most modern > terminal emulators support it. As much as I feel the need to yank out rmcup > an smcup from our terminfo database, we are using a feature, as distasteful > as it may feel. This change probably needs a relnotes=yes and an UPDATING > entry advising users that they can either change $TERM to xterm1, vt100, or > some other terminal definition that doesn't support rmcup and smcup, or > learn to like it. > > OTOH, maybe this is something we as a community don't really want and we > remove the rmcup and smcup definitions from our terminfo database. > Personally, I believe this is progress -- progress I'm not particularly > enamoured with but progress nonetheless.
